In 2019-2020, 2,415 people earned their degree in food science technology, making the major the 183rd most popular in the United States. In 2017-2018, food science technology gra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$42,382 and had an average of $21,826 in loans still to pay off.

Across North Carolina, there were 71 food science techn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$27,000 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 3 food science techn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$72,103 and $114,434 respectively.

North Carolina State University

Raleigh, North Carolina
#1 in overall quality

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end North Carolina State University.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Food Science Tech Schools for a Doctorate in North Carolina. NC State is a large public school situated in Raleigh, North Carolina. It awarded 3 doctorate’s food science tech degrees in 2019-2020.

NC State also made our “Best Food Science Technology Doctor’s Degree Schools in North Carolina” list, coming in at #1. Average graduate tuition and fees at North Carolina State University are $28,999, but some majors have different tuition rates.
